What Is a Smart Lighting System?

First, let’s define what smart lighting is and what this system entails. It’s more than just a technologically advanced bulb that you can control from an app on your smartphone.

Essentially, a smart lighting system is the intuitive integration of all the lighting in your house. You can create multiple functions and settings with them, all in which you can control remotely.

You can do the remote control functions by using a mobile app, voice assistants, keypads, touchscreens, or remote control.

Some of the controls you can do are dimming the lights, changing their colors and hues, turning light fixtures on or off as a cluster or individually, or setting a specific mood.

With a single action, you can set a lighting mood in your home. Whether you want to dim the lights when you want to watch a movie in the living room, turn the brightness up in the kitchen when you’re cooking a meal, or turn the lights on remotely even when you’re away to ward off intruders.

Smart Lighting Installation

There are two primary ways of installing smart lighting systems.

Wireless Installation

If you want to retrofit smart lighting in your home, your best option is wireless installation. This procedure uses the existing wires that connect your lighting switches.

However, the regular switches are removed and replaced with either a keypad or smart switch that can be integrated wirelessly to the central controller.

Centralized Installation

This type of smart lighting installation is ideal for new homes that are being constructed or properties undergoing significant renovations.

The way this installation works is the lights are all connected to the main location, similar to a breaker box. It’s then hardwired and integrated into the central smart home automation system.

What You Can Do with Smart Lighting

Smart Lighting Can Help Keep Your Home Safe While You’re Away

With its remote access features, you can utilize smart lighting to help prevent burglars or thieves targeting your home.

Turn the lights on or off to make it appear someone’s home even when you’re away. Having this option adds a layer of security to your home. This feature is perfect when you are out of town or away on holiday.

Energy Efficiency Is a Big Deal

Smart lights are a big help towards your home energy efficiency efforts. With smart lights, you can set them to turn on, off, dimmer, or brighter, at specific times that they are needed or not.

Even if you forget to switch the lights off after leaving your house, you can remedy that by controlling them remotely. This way, you’re not wasting any power.

Make the Holidays Lovely

You can set your smart lighting in a certain mood to get you into the holiday spirit. What’s fantastic is you can do all these settings without the inconvenience of turning the lights on and off every single time.
